46 Bible Verses about God Answering Prayers

Most Relevant Verses

Psalm 118:21

I will give thanks unto thee; for thou hast answered me, And art become my salvation.

Proverbs 1:28

Then will they call upon me, but I will not answer; They will seek me diligently, but they shall not find me:

Psalm 66:19

But verily God hath heard; He hath attended to the voice of my prayer.

Job 22:27

Thou shalt make thy prayer unto him, and he will hear thee; And thou shalt pay thy vows.

Psalm 143:1

Hear my prayer, O Jehovah; give ear to my supplications: In thy faithfulness answer me, and in thy righteousness.

Psalm 34:17

The righteous cried, and Jehovah heard, And delivered them out of all their troubles.

Isaiah 1:15

And when ye spread forth your hands, I will hide mine eyes from you; yea, when ye make many prayers, I will not hear: your hands are full of blood.

Job 35:13

Surely God will not hear an empty cry , Neither will the Almighty regard it.

1 Kings 18:24

And call ye on the name of your god, and I will call on the name of Jehovah; and the God that answereth by fire, let him be God. And all the people answered and said, It is well spoken.

Acts 10:31

and saith, Cornelius, thy prayer is heard, and thine alms are had in remembrance in the sight of God.

Jeremiah 14:11

And Jehovah said unto me, Pray not for this people for their good.

Psalm 17:6

I have called upon thee, for thou wilt answer me, O God: Incline thine ear unto me, and hear my speech.

Revelation 8:4

And the smoke of the incense, with the prayers of the saints, went up before God out of the angel's hand.

Psalm 69:13

But as for me, my prayer is unto thee, O Jehovah, in an acceptable time: O God, in the abundance of thy lovingkindness, Answer me in the truth of thy salvation.

1 John 5:15

and if we know that he heareth us whatsoever we ask, we know that we have the petitions which we have asked of him.

Daniel 9:23

At the beginning of thy supplications the commandment went forth, and I am come to tell thee; for thou art greatly beloved: therefore consider the matter, and understand the vision.

1 Kings 8:29

that thine eyes may be open toward this house night and day, even toward the place whereof thou hast said, My name shall be there; to hearken unto the prayer which thy servant shall pray toward this place.

Daniel 9:20

And while I was speaking, and praying, and confessing my sin and the sin of my people Israel, and presenting my supplication before Jehovah my God for the holy mountain of my God;

Micah 3:4

Then shall they cry unto Jehovah, but he will not answer them; yea, he will hide his face from them at that time, according as they have wrought evil in their doings.

1 Kings 8:28

Yet have thou respect unto the prayer of thy servant, and to his supplication, O Jehovah my God, to hearken unto the cry and to the prayer which thy servant prayeth before thee this day;

Nehemiah 2:4

Then the king said unto me, For what dost thou make request? So I prayed to the God of heaven.

Daniel 10:12

Then said he unto me, Fear not, Daniel; for from the first day that thou didst set thy heart to understand, and to humble thyself before thy God, thy words were heard: and I am come for thy words'sake.
